Webb14 dec. 2024 · 1 The 68-95-99.7% rule can only be validly applied to a normal distribution. Your data are from a finite sample, so the rule does not apply. You don't need the rule though. You can just count. "Within one standard deviation of the mean" means within the interval [ x ¯ − σ, x ¯ + σ] = [ 34.7 − 25.4, 34.7 + 25.4] = [ 9.3, 60.1]. WebbThe range is the difference between the highest and lowest values within a set of numbers. To calculate range, subtract the smallest number from the largest number in the set. If a six-server rack includes 90 W, 98 W, 100 W, 102 W, 105 W and 110 W, the power consumption range is 110 W - 90 W = 20 W.
